For paper or electronic navigation charts (ENC), this is THE ONE you need in print!
Written an printed by US government; this is the one in print you MUST have available at the chart table.Very well laid out and easy to find what you need, fast.Prints every 5 years or so (last edition was 2013 and "assume" this 2019 edition will go to reprint in 2024 or 2025). Also available "online" or PDF, but I find having this in print, by the chart table, to be very comforting, especially in any harbor I am not especially familiar with.EDC charts are great! But you better know wall all the dots, dashes, lines, etc. mean, or you will be "trading paint" with something.
